Siberian Husky vs Rottweiler vs Shiba Inu Size and Weight Comparison
Size
Which is bigger, Siberian Husky or Rottweiler or Shiba Inu? Which is the smallest dog, Siberian Husky or Rottweiler or Shiba Inu? | Medium | Large Giant | Medium |
---|---|---|---|
Weight
Which is heavier, Siberian Husky or Rottweiler or Rottweiler? Siberian Husky vs Rottweiler vs Shiba Inu weight comparison: | Male: 45–60 pounds (20–27 kg), Female: 35–50 pounds (16–23 kg) | Male: 95-130 pounds (43-59 kg), Female: 85-115 pounds (38-52 kg) | Male: 18-25 pounds (8-11 kg), Female: 15-20 pounds (6.8-9 kg) |
Average Weight
Which dog has a smaller / higher average weight? | Male: 45–60 pounds (20–27 kg), Female: 35–50 pounds (16–23 kg) | Male: 112.5 pounds (51 kg), Female: 100 pounds (45 kg) | Male: 21.5 pounds (9.5 kg), Female: 17.5 pounds (6.8.5 kg) |
Height
Which is taller, Siberian Husky or Rottweiler or Shiba Inu? Siberian Husky vs Rottweiler vs Shiba Inu height comparison: | Male: 21–24 inches (53–61 cm), Female: 20–22 inches (51–56 cm) | Male: 24-27 inches (61-69 cm), Female: 22-25 inches (56-63 cm) | Male: 14-16 inches (36-41 cm), Female: 13-15 inches (33-38 cm) |
Average Height
Which dog has a smaller / higher average height? | Male: 21–24 inches (53–61 cm), Female: 20–22 inches (51–56 cm) | Male: 25.5 inches (65 cm), Female: 23.5 inches (59.5 cm) | Male: 15 inches (38.5 cm), Female: 14 inches (35.5 cm) |

Siberian Husky vs Rottweiler vs Shiba Inu Recognition Comparison
AKC Group
Which dog is recognized by the AKC? |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1930 as a Working breed. |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1931 as a Working breed. |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1992 as a Non-Sporting breed. |
---|---|---|---|
FCI Group
Which dog is recognized by the FCI? | Recognized by FCI in the Spitz and primitive types group, in the Nordic Sledge Dogs section. | Recognized by FCI in the Pinscher and Schnauzer - Molossoid and Swiss Mountain and Cattledogs group, in the Molossian type section. | Recognized by FCI in the Spitz and primitive types group, in the Asian Spitz and related breeds section. |
